_grabMouse() | Ogre::SDLInput | [private] |
_key_map | Ogre::SDLInput | [private] |
_releaseMouse() | Ogre::SDLInput | [private] |
_visible | Ogre::SDLInput | [private] |
addCursorMoveListener(MouseMotionListener *c) | Ogre::InputReader | |
BufferedKeysDownSet typedef | Ogre::InputReader | [protected] |
capture() | Ogre::SDLInput | [virtual] |
createKeyEvent(int id, int key) | Ogre::InputReader | [protected] |
createMouseEvent(int id, int button) | Ogre::InputReader | [protected] |
getKeyChar(int keyCode, long modifiers=0) | Ogre::InputReader | [static] |
getMouseAbsX() const | Ogre::SDLInput | [virtual] |
getMouseAbsY() const | Ogre::SDLInput | [virtual] |
getMouseAbsZ() const | Ogre::SDLInput | [virtual] |
getMouseButton(uchar button) const | Ogre::SDLInput | [virtual] |
getMouseRelativeX() const | Ogre::InputReader | [virtual] |
getMouseRelativeY() const | Ogre::InputReader | [virtual] |
getMouseRelativeZ() const | Ogre::InputReader | [virtual] |
getMouseRelX() const | Ogre::SDLInput | [virtual] |
getMouseRelY() const | Ogre::SDLInput | [virtual] |
getMouseRelZ() const | Ogre::SDLInput | [virtual] |
getMouseScale(void) const | Ogre::InputReader | [virtual] |
getMouseState(MouseState &state) const | Ogre::SDLInput | [virtual] |
initialise(RenderWindow *pWindow, bool useKeyboard=true, bool useMouse=true, bool useGameController=false) | Ogre::SDLInput | [virtual] |
InputKeyMap typedef | Ogre::SDLInput | [private] |
InputReader() | Ogre::InputReader | |
isKeyDown(KeyCode kc) const | Ogre::InputReader | [virtual] |
isKeyDownImmediate(KeyCode kc) const | Ogre::SDLInput | [private, virtual] |
keyChanged(int key, bool down) | Ogre::InputReader | [protected] |
mBufferedKeysDown | Ogre::InputReader | [protected] |
mCursor | Ogre::InputReader | [protected] |
mEventQueue | Ogre::InputReader | [protected] |
mGrabMode | Ogre::SDLInput | [private] |
mGrabMouse | Ogre::SDLInput | [private] |
mKeyboardBuffer | Ogre::SDLInput | [private] |
mMaxKey | Ogre::SDLInput | [private] |
mModifiers | Ogre::InputReader | [protected] |
mMouseGrabbed | Ogre::SDLInput | [private] |
mMouseKeys | Ogre::SDLInput | [private] |
mMouseLeft | Ogre::SDLInput | [private] |
mMouseRelativeX | Ogre::SDLInput | [private] |
mMouseRelativeY | Ogre::SDLInput | [private] |
mMouseRelativeZ | Ogre::SDLInput | [private] |
mMouseScale | Ogre::InputReader | [protected] |
mMouseState | Ogre::InputReader | [protected] |
mMouseX | Ogre::SDLInput | [private] |
mMouseY | Ogre::SDLInput | [private] |
mouseMoved() | Ogre::InputReader | [protected] |
mUseBufferedKeys | Ogre::InputReader | [protected] |
mUseBufferedMouse | Ogre::InputReader | [protected] |
mUseMouse | Ogre::SDLInput | [private] |
mWheelStep | Ogre::SDLInput | [private, static] |
processBufferedKeyboard() | Ogre::SDLInput | [private] |
processBufferedMouse() | Ogre::SDLInput | [private] |
removeCursorMoveListener(MouseMotionListener *c) | Ogre::InputReader | |
SDLInput() | Ogre::SDLInput | |
setBufferedInput(bool keys, bool mouse) | Ogre::InputReader | [virtual] |
setGrabMode(GrabMode mode) | Ogre::SDLInput | |
setMouseScale(Real scale) | Ogre::InputReader | [virtual] |
triggerMouseButton(int nMouseCode, bool mousePressed) | Ogre::InputReader | [protected] |
useBufferedInput(EventQueue *pEventQueue, bool keys=true, bool mouse=true) | Ogre::InputReader | |
warpMouse | Ogre::SDLInput | [private] |
~InputReader() | Ogre::InputReader | [virtual] |
~SDLInput() | Ogre::SDLInput | [virtual] |